Early Seventeenth Century English Book Cover
The Victoria and Albert Museum, London, has in its collection a book cover made in England, which dates to about 1634 and measures 17.8 x 12.1 x 6.5 cm. It is made of board covered with satin and embroidered with silver and silver gilt threads, with purl and coil, and with coloured silks and plaited threads.
